  • Title

    All-optical demultiplexing of a signal using collision and waveguiding of spatial solitons

  • Abstract
    The basic principle of a new all-optical demultiplexer is experimentally demonstrated. It relies on the interaction between an input signal and two colliding spatial solitons of a different wavelength in a planar nonlinear waveguide.
